The old Redcine has cool framing which is lacking in RedCine-X. We may need that feature back Red Team.

What I meant by is,

When I set my project resolution and adjust the width and height and aspect ratio of final delivery, I can see the real time preview of my content as well as the out of frame areas, which is lacking in RedCine-X.
 
Pretty sure it's coming, just hasn't been implemented yet...

RCX is a complete rewrite so every feature has to be written from the ground up so it takes time. We have a request list with a couple hundred items on it...
